Description

The Senior Lighting Artist will work closely with the Project Art Director to support the project with environment lighting. This role requires a balance of artistic creativity and technical expertise, particularly with Unreal Engine 5. Proficiency in both baked and real-time lighting techniques is essential.

Day To Day

Responsibilities

  • Create environment lighting for projects, combining artistry with technical expertise.
  • Work both independently and within a group on various projects.
  • Understand what the Project Art Director requires for the project and translate it into the engine by researching, developing, and implementing lighting solutions, with a strong focus on mood and player engagement.
  • Research current techniques used and utilize the most relevant processes.
  • Strong ability to quickly learn and adapt to project workflows, tools, and requirements.

Skills Knowledge and Expertise

Must Haves

  • Understanding of Maya and / or Max.
  • Unreal experience is required; familiarity with Unity is a plus.
  • Creates impactful environment lighting, consistently pushing the boundaries of visual quality and innovation.
  • Ability to create environment lighting using engine tools or plugins.
  • Ability to create lighting tailored to diverse environmental concepts.
  • Ability to light a scene to enhance and match the mood and impact in the game.
  • Ability to create lighting setups that support design with gameplay in mind.
  • Ability to keep an organized and consistent schedule.
  • Strong communication skills with both internal and external stakeholders.
  • Ability to provide accurate time estimates for project planning.
  • Understanding of bug fixing and investigation.
  • Ability to help the art team find answers to difficult problems.
  • Works closely with technical art to develop new or improved upon techniques to improve visual quality.
  • Work effectively with other departments as needed.
